## Health Checks Behind the Balancer

Plugin authors: the Korvath balancer probes `/healthz` on each node every 5s. Your plugin must answer within 200ms or the node is drained. Deep checks (including DB reachability) run on `/readyz` only. To verify your plugin's readiness probe locally, point it at the shared staging database using the connection string below.

warehouse DSN: mssql://rusdor_svc:0FSWCn9@db-951a.paliqforge.local:5432/ulawyn

A: PickPath, the pick-list optimizer in the Gantry warehouse suite, only accepts plugin suggestions that pass the aisle-conflict check. If your routes touch a locked zone, they're silently dropped — check the rejection counter in the plugin dashboard. Also confirm your plugin declares the `route.suggest` capability in its manifest; undeclared capabilities are stripped at load time. Version pinning matters: build against optimizer API v4 or later. Unresolved cases go to the address below.

escalation mailbox, yafog-kafof: eliok@xolmarcloud.local

Internal Memo – Quillbase Software

To: Sales Leads

Effective next quarter, Quillbase is moving new contracts for the Ledgerline suite to annual billing by default. Monthly plans remain available only with director approval. Pricing sheets will be updated next week; talk tracks and objection-handling notes follow from Dario's team. Existing customers are unaffected until renewal. Apply the new terms to all open proposals from the first of the month. Please also review the confidential note appended below.

internal memo for faweg-tafog: Only 7 of the 100 pilot accounts renewed Quenael, so a churn review is set for April 15.